Rhonda Jo Carter, 72, of Hot Springs Village, Arkansas, passed away on April 3rd, 2026 in Hot Springs Village.
Viewing will be Sunday, April 12 from 5 pm – 7pm and Monday, April 13th from 9:00 am – 11:00 am at Hamil Family Funeral Home, 6499 Buffalo Gap Road in Abilene, TX.
Graveside funeral services will be held at 2:00 pm on Monday, April 13th, at the Rule Cemetery located at 476 CR 128 in Rule, TX. Services are under the direction of The Hamil Family Funeral Home.
Rhonda was born in Knox City, Texas to Joan Billings and Buck Meinzer on March 31st, 1954. She attended Baird High School and was one of the most talented and beautiful twirlers to ever grace the field before moving to Abilene, TX to graduate from Abilene High School. After high school, Rhonda embarked on her most important role by bringing her son, Michael Brandon Gibbs, into the world. In addition to motherhood, Rhonda took on many work challenges. She was a television weather girl, a radio disc jockey, an office manager, and an oilfield roustabout. She could do it all. Rhonda was outgoing, passionate, and excitable. She was a gifted encourager and an excellent listener. She loved genuinely and deeply, and she was not afraid to let her feelings show. Rhonda found joy in lifting others’ spirits, and she was quick to praise based on true and recognized merits. Rhonda could find humor in just about everything; even when it ought not be found, and she absolutely perfected the “Webb Laugh.” She was one of a kind. Her laughter, love, and encouragement will be greatly missed. Rhonda’s most important decision was placing her faith in her Savior, Jesus Christ. Because of this, she began rejoicing in his presence on Friday, April 3rd, 2026.
Rhonda was preceded in death by her mother, Joan Billings, her father, Walter Buck Meinzer, her stepmother, Betty Reeves Meinzer, a niece, Sara Phillips, and the last love of her life L.P. “Pat” Carter.
Rhonda is survived and celebrated by her son Michael Brandon Gibbs and wife Joy of San Angelo, her two grandchildren Brennon Gibbs and Bryana Gibbs of San Angelo, sisters Celeste Rooney and husband Bill of St. Louis, Missouri, and Pam Meinzer of Arlington; brothers Walter Greg Meinzer of Fallon, Nevada, Joe David Meinzer and wife Sheryl of Lubbock, Walter Buck Meinzer, Jr. and wife Jennifer of Midlothian, John Baum and wife Linda of Coleman, Jim Baum and wife Kelly of Albany, and Jeff Baum and wife Kelly of Lubbock. Rhonda is also survived by her stepfather and friend, Donald Billings of Hot Springs Village, Arkansas and many nieces, nephews, and cousins.
Pallbearers will be Michael Gibbs, Brennon Gibbs, John Baum, Jim Baum, Jeff Baum, and Parker Baum.
Memorials may be given in Rhonda’s memory to any entity that helps care for and/or rehome animals.
